* Please note April 2014 sales numbers are rounded to the last digit. Additionally, Nissan's Asia and Oceania region does not include Japan, mainland China and India.
HONG KONG, May 19, 2014 /PRNewswire/ -- Nissan announced today total Asia and Oceania sales for April of 18,470 units, a 2.9 percent decline from a year earlier.
April highlights:
- Sales in Thailand showed momentum over the prior year, thanks to an effective sales campaign launched at the Bangkok International Motor Show. Teana sales for April reached a record 1,130 units, up 146 percent vs. the prior month, recording its best sales month since its launch in October 2013.
- Sylphy, which launched in Malaysia on April 29, has had a good start, with 200 orders booked and positive feedback from customers and media.
- Other A&O markets performed strongly: Korea had its best April sales driven by Altima and sales in New Zealand were up 125 percent from prior year, with Pulsar and the new X-Trail being key contributors. X-Trail in New Zealand achieved best-selling SUV status for the month.
